What is FBLA?

Future Business Leaders of America (FBLA) is the premier student business organization in the United States with over 200,000 members nationwide.

Founded in 1940, FBLA prepares students for careers in business through academic competitions, leadership development, and community service.

At Cinco Ranch High School, our chapter is one of the most active and successful in the region.
